Output 5a96564ddf412a13276b33893ceb805097b3ec306670f50d324b715d9a3dd0cb:2

value
21954059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acdf1415675f5d88b8f7ae5d1e04a0ba879daef9 OP_EQUAL
address
MPfDhBqE4xUV3nWzuCQkeZ8BkZDddaXnkw
transaction
5a96564ddf412a13276b33893ceb805097b3ec306670f50d324b715d9a3dd0cb
spent
true